                                  BOOK FEST 2007
                                                                                   
                                                                                   
 Once again, Book Fest 2007 will bring people together to share the joys of
 reading and talking about books for children and teens.
                                                                                   
                                                                                   
 The Office of Children?s Services and The Office of Young Adult Services of The
 New York Public Library are pleased to continue this special event. To kick the
 morning off, Lois Lowry, recipient of the 2007 Margaret A. Edwards Award honoring
 her outstanding lifetime contribution to writing for teens and winner of Newbery
 Medals for The Giver and Number the Stars, will be our keynote speaker. Lois
 Lowry is the author of many books for children and teens. Her most recent titles
 are Gossamer , an ALA Notable Children?s Book, and Gooney the Fabulous . Lois
 Lowry is also a contributor to a new collection of short stories entitled Shining
 on: 11 Star Authors? Illuminating Stories .
                                                                                   
                                                                                   
 Next it will be time for you to discuss books in our small book discussion
 groups. Choose one of the eleven groups listed by age to the right. Each is led
 by a well-known children?s or young adult literature specialist in the New York
 City area. Make a selection and read all the books listed so you can share in the
 discussion.
                                                                                   
                                                                                   
 Our afternoon panel will feature an exciting array of talented authors and
 illustrators dedicated to using technology to create art in children?s books.
                                                                                   
 William Low has won numerous awards including four Silver medals from the Society
 of Illustrators. His books include Chinatown (author/illustrator), The Days of
 Summer by Eve Bunting and Henry and the Kite Dragon by Bruce Edward Hall, and Old
 Penn Station (author/illustrator).
                                                                                   
                                                                                   
 J. Otto Seibold, author/illustrator of Olive the Other Reindeer, was one of the
 first children's book artists to create computer-generated art and is considered
 the master of that medium. His most recent book is Mind Your Manners, B. B. Wolf,
 written by Judy Sierra.
                                                                                   
 John Grandits is an award-winning book and magazine designer and the author of
 "Beatrice Black Bear," a monthly cartoon for Click magazine. Technically It's Not
 My Fault, his first book of concrete poems, is and ALA Notable Book. Blue
 Lipstick is his most recent book of concrete poetry.
                                                                                   
 To keep your energy flowing, there will be morning coffee, a gourmet lunch, and a
 sherry hour at the day?s conclusion. Book sales and autographing by our featured
 presenters will add to the day?s enjoyment.
